Waupaca's game on Tuesday was all tied up 1-1 at the half, but sadly for them it didn't stay that way. They fell just short of the Marinette Marines by a score of 2-1. Waupaca's defeat continues a trend for the team, making it three in a row.
Their goal came courtesy of Brody Woitczak, who's now up to four this season.
Waupaca's loss dropped their record down to 1-4. As for Marinette, the victory was the third in a row for them, bringing their record up to 3-1.
Waupaca didn't take long to hit the pitch again: they've already played their next contest, a 3-2 defeat against Adams-Friendship on the 11th. As for Marinette, they will challenge Peshtigo at 4:00 p.m. on Wednesday.
